Show The merits of the scratching shed are shown during bad weather. Poultry and eggs bring good prices now-a-days. Some of the causes of roup are sudden sud-den and extreme changes in temperature, tempera-ture, damp bouses and draughts. A good poultryman is industrious, not easily discouraged, filled with pluck and grit and full of ambition. Have your fowls so tame that you can go among them without causing fright. You will get better egg production. pro-duction. Excited men and women make excited ex-cited birds, and that has a bad effect on the egg-producing mechanism of the birds. Do not put males in adjoining pens with only netting between them. Have a twelve-Inch board at the bottom of each partition. Hens will eat a great quantity of coal cinders and they are very good for them. Try putting a load in the chicken yard and watch the result. |
